Then press the Enter key. 4 GETTING TO KNOW YOUR ROUTER A) Status Light Your Router’s status is shown by the light on the front. Off: The Router is not plugged into a power source. Blinking Blue: The Router is starting up. Solid Blue: The Router is connected to the Internet. Blinking Amber: The Router can’t detect the modem. Either the modem is off, is not plugged into the Router, or is unresponsive. Front Panel B) Wi-Fi Protected Setup (WPS) Light and Button The WPS button on the front of your Router can be used to help establish a secure connection between your Router and other WPS-enabled Wi-Fi devices such as computers. To use the WPS feature on your Router, refer to the Router’s web interface. The small light near the WPS button shows what is happening while you are using WPS to establish a connection. Off: Idle Blinking Blue: The Router is listening for a WPS-enabled computer or other device. Solid Blue: The Router has made a secure connection with the computer or other device. Amber: A connection was not created. Maximum Permissible Exposure 1.1. Applicable Standard Systems operating under the provisions of this section shall be operated in a manner that ensures that the public is not exposed to radio frequency energy levels in excess limit for maximum permissible exposure. In accordance with 47 CFR FCC Part 2 Subpart J, section 2.1091 this device has been defined as a mobile device whereby a distance of 0.2 m normally can be maintained between the user and the device. (A) Limits for Occupational / Controlled Exposure Frequency Range (MHz) Electric Field Strength (E) (V/m) Magnetic Field Strength (H) (A/m) Power Density (S) (mW/ cm²) Averaging Time |E|²,|H|² or S (minutes) 0.3-3.0 614 1.63 (100)* 6 3.0-30 1842 / f 4.89 / f (900 / f)* 6 30-300 61.4 0.163 1.0 6 300-1500 F/300 6 1500-100,000 5 6 (B) Limits for General Population / Uncontrolled Exposure Frequency Range (MHz) Electric Field Strength (E) (V/m) Magnetic Field Strength (H) (A/m) Power Density (S) (mW/ cm²) Averaging Time |E|²,|H|² or S (minutes) 0.3-1.34 614 1.63 (100)* 30 1.34-30 824/f 2.19/f (180/f)* 30 30-300 27.5 0.073 0.2 30 300-1500 F/1500 30 1500-100,000 1.0 30 Note: f = frequency in MHz ; *Plane-wave equivalent power density 1.2. MPE Calculation Method E (V/m) = d GP30 Power Density: Pd (W/m²) = 377 2 E E = Electric field (V/m) P = Peak RF output power (W) G = EUT Antenna numeric gain (numeric) d = Separation distance between radiator and human body (m) The formula can be changed to Pd = 2 377 30 d GP From the peak EUT RF output power, the minimum mobile separation distance, d=0.2m, as well as the gain of the used antenna, the RF power density can be obtained.
